Transaction 0ad2d9436ca3097f09a28303a0abe8146e545c61463ab48ae76afb5ba0ed670a
1 Input
1 Output
-
0ad2d9436ca3097f09a28303a0abe8146e545c61463ab48ae76afb5ba0ed670a:0
- value
- 21389733
- script pubkey
- OP_0 OP_PUSHBYTES_20 6641238d6113a1ea1e89b0278e5c5aa5944fb3ae
- address
- bc1qveqj8rtpzws7585fkqncuhz65k2ylvawaumy6g